Income too lowAny other thoughts?
Financial associate problems
Not on Electoral Roll
Time at address not long enough
Too many addresses in recent years
Not traceable on the Electoral Roll continuously over the last few years
How many credit accounts are shown on your credit report (open and settled)?
But, Tesco are known to be picky so it could be you just don't meet the profile of their target customer.0 -
